<directivesynopsis>
|
|
<name>AcceptFilter</name>
|
|
<description>Configures optimizations for a Protocol's Listener Sockets</description>
|
|
<syntax>AcceptFilter <var>protocol</var> <var>accept_filter</var></syntax>
|
|
<contextlist><context>server config</context></contextlist>
|
|
|
|
<usage>
|
|
<p>This directive enables operating system specific optimizations for a
|
|
listening socket by the <directive>Protocol</directive> type.
|
|
The basic premise is for the kernel to not send a socket to the server
|
|
process until either data is received or an entire HTTP Request is buffered.
|
|
Only <a href="http://www.freebsd.org/cgi/man.cgi?query=accept_filter&sektion=9">
|
|
FreeBSD's Accept Filters</a>, Linux's more primitive
|
|
<code>TCP_DEFER_ACCEPT</code>, and Windows' optimized AcceptEx()
|
|
are currently supported.</p>
|
|
|
|
<p>Using <code>none</code> for an argument will disable any accept filters
|
|
for that protocol. This is useful for protocols that require a server
|
|
send data first, such as <code>ftp:</code> or <code>nntp</code>:</p>
|
|
<highlight language="config">
|
|
AcceptFilter nntp none
|
|
</highlight>
|
|
|
|
<p>The default protocol names are <code>https</code> for port 443
|
|
and <code>http</code> for all other ports. To specify that another
|
|
protocol is being used with a listening port, add the <var>protocol</var>
|
|
argument to the <directive module="mpm_common">Listen</directive>
|
|
directive.</p>
|
|
|
|
<p>The default values on FreeBSD are:</p>
|
|
<highlight language="config">
|
|
AcceptFilter http httpready
|
|
AcceptFilter https dataready
|
|
</highlight>
|
|
|
|
<p>The <code>httpready</code> accept filter buffers entire HTTP requests at
|
|
the kernel level. Once an entire request is received, the kernel then
|
|
sends it to the server. See the
|
|
<a href="http://www.freebsd.org/cgi/man.cgi?query=accf_http&sektion=9">
|
|
accf_http(9)</a> man page for more details. Since HTTPS requests are
|
|
encrypted, only the <a href="http://www.freebsd.org/cgi/man.cgi?query=accf_data&sektion=9">
|
|
accf_data(9)</a> filter is used.</p>
|
|
|
|
<p>The default values on Linux are:</p>
|
|
<highlight language="config">
|
|
AcceptFilter http data
|
|
AcceptFilter https data
|
|
</highlight>
|
|
|
|
<p>Linux's <code>TCP_DEFER_ACCEPT</code> does not support buffering http
|
|
requests. Any value besides <code>none</code> will enable
|
|
<code>TCP_DEFER_ACCEPT</code> on that listener. For more details
|
|
see the Linux
|
|
<a href="http://man7.org/linux/man-pages/man7/tcp.7.html">
|
|
tcp(7)</a> man page.</p>
|
|
|
|
<p>The default values on Windows are:</p>
|
|
<highlight language="config">
|
|
AcceptFilter http connect
|
|
AcceptFilter https connect
|
|
</highlight>
|
|
|
|
<p>Window's mpm_winnt interprets the AcceptFilter to toggle the AcceptEx()
|
|
API, and does not support http protocol buffering. <code>connect</code>
|
|
will use the AcceptEx() API, also retrieve the network endpoint
|
|
addresses, but like <code>none</code> the <code>connect</code> option
|
|
does not wait for the initial data transmission.</p>
|
|
|
|
<p>On Windows, <code>none</code> uses accept() rather than AcceptEx()
|
|
and will not recycle sockets between connections. This is useful for
|
|
network adapters with broken driver support, as well as some virtual
|
|
network providers such as vpn drivers, or spam, virus or spyware
|
|
filters.</p>
|
|
|
|
<note type="warning">
|
|
<title>The <code>data</code> AcceptFilter (Windows)</title>
|
|
|
|
<p>For versions 2.4.23 and prior, the Windows <code>data</code> accept
|
|
filter waited until data had been transmitted and the initial data
|
|
buffer and network endpoint addresses had been retrieved from the
|
|
single AcceptEx() invocation. This implementation was subject to a
|
|
denial of service attack and has been disabled.</p>
|
|
|
|
<p>Current releases of httpd default to the <code>connect</code> filter
|
|
on Windows, and will fall back to <code>connect</code> if
|
|
<code>data</code> is specified. Users of prior releases are encouraged
|
|
to add an explicit setting of <code>connect</code> for their
|
|
AcceptFilter, as shown above.</p>
|
|
</note>
|
|
|
|
</usage>

<directivesynopsis>
|
|
<name>AcceptPathInfo</name>
|
|
<description>Resources accept trailing pathname information</description>
|
|
<syntax>AcceptPathInfo On|Off|Default</syntax>
|
|
<default>AcceptPathInfo Default</default>
|
|
<contextlist><context>server config</context>
|
|
<context>virtual host</context><context>directory</context>
|
|
<context>.htaccess</context></contextlist>
|
|
<override>FileInfo</override>
|
|
|
|
<usage>
|
|
|
|
<p>This directive controls whether requests that contain trailing
|
|
pathname information that follows an actual filename (or
|
|
non-existent file in an existing directory) will be accepted or
|
|
rejected. The trailing pathname information can be made
|
|
available to scripts in the <code>PATH_INFO</code> environment
|
|
variable.</p>
|
|
|
|
<p>For example, assume the location <code>/test/</code> points to
|
|
a directory that contains only the single file
|
|
<code>here.html</code>. Then requests for
|
|
<code>/test/here.html/more</code> and
|
|
<code>/test/nothere.html/more</code> both collect
|
|
<code>/more</code> as <code>PATH_INFO</code>.</p>
|
|
|
|
<p>The three possible arguments for the
|
|
<directive>AcceptPathInfo</directive> directive are:</p>
|
|
<dl>
|
|
<dt><code>Off</code></dt><dd>A request will only be accepted if it
|
|
maps to a literal path that exists. Therefore a request with
|
|
trailing pathname information after the true filename such as
|
|
<code>/test/here.html/more</code> in the above example will return
|
|
a 404 NOT FOUND error.</dd>
|
|
|
|
<dt><code>On</code></dt><dd>A request will be accepted if a
|
|
leading path component maps to a file that exists. The above
|
|
example <code>/test/here.html/more</code> will be accepted if
|
|
<code>/test/here.html</code> maps to a valid file.</dd>
|
|
|
|
<dt><code>Default</code></dt><dd>The treatment of requests with
|
|
trailing pathname information is determined by the <a
|
|
href="../handler.html">handler</a> responsible for the request.
|
|
The core handler for normal files defaults to rejecting
|
|
<code>PATH_INFO</code> requests. Handlers that serve scripts, such as <a
|
|
href="mod_cgi.html">cgi-script</a> and <a
|
|
href="mod_isapi.html">isapi-handler</a>, generally accept
|
|
<code>PATH_INFO</code> by default.</dd>
|
|
</dl>
|
|
|
|
<p>The primary purpose of the <code>AcceptPathInfo</code>
|
|
directive is to allow you to override the handler's choice of
|
|
accepting or rejecting <code>PATH_INFO</code>. This override is required,
|
|
for example, when you use a <a href="../filter.html">filter</a>, such
|
|
as <a href="mod_include.html">INCLUDES</a>, to generate content
|
|
based on <code>PATH_INFO</code>. The core handler would usually reject
|
|
the request, so you can use the following configuration to enable
|
|
such a script:</p>
|
|
|
|
<highlight language="config">
|
|
<Files "mypaths.shtml">
|
|
Options +Includes
|
|
SetOutputFilter INCLUDES
|
|
AcceptPathInfo On
|
|
</Files>
|
|
</highlight>
|
|
|
|
</usage>

<directivesynopsis>
|
|
<name>AllowOverride</name>
|
|
<description>Types of directives that are allowed in
|
|
<code>.htaccess</code> files</description>
|
|
<syntax>AllowOverride All|None|<var>directive-type</var>
|
|
[<var>directive-type</var>] ...</syntax>
|
|
<default>AllowOverride None (2.3.9 and later), AllowOverride All (2.3.8 and earlier)</default>
|
|
<contextlist><context>directory</context></contextlist>
|
|
|
|
<usage>
|
|
<p>When the server finds an <code>.htaccess</code> file (as
|
|
specified by <directive module="core">AccessFileName</directive>),
|
|
it needs to know which directives declared in that file can override
|
|
earlier configuration directives.</p>
|
|
|
|
<note><title>Only available in <Directory> sections</title>
|
|
<directive>AllowOverride</directive> is valid only in
|
|
<directive type="section" module="core">Directory</directive>
|
|
sections specified without regular expressions, not in <directive
|
|
type="section" module="core">Location</directive>, <directive
|
|
module="core" type="section">DirectoryMatch</directive> or
|
|
<directive type="section" module="core">Files</directive> sections.
|
|
</note>
|
|
|
|
<p>When this directive is set to <code>None</code> and <directive
|
|
module="core">AllowOverrideList</directive> is set to
|
|
<code>None</code>, <a href="#accessfilename">.htaccess</a> files are
|
|
completely ignored. In this case, the server will not even attempt
|
|
to read <code>.htaccess</code> files in the filesystem.</p>
|
|
|
|
<p>When this directive is set to <code>All</code>, then any
|
|
directive which has the .htaccess <a
|
|
href="directive-dict.html#Context">Context</a> is allowed in
|
|
<code>.htaccess</code> files.</p>
|
|
|
|
<p>The <var>directive-type</var> can be one of the following
|
|
groupings of directives. (See the <a href="overrides.html">override class
|
|
index</a> for an up-to-date listing of which directives are enabled by each
|
|
<var>directive-type</var>.)</p>
|
|
|
|
<dl>
|
|
<dt><a href="overrides.html#override-authconfig">AuthConfig</a></dt>
|
|
|
|
<dd>
|
|
|
|
Allow use of the authorization directives (<directive
|
|
module="mod_authz_dbm">AuthDBMGroupFile</directive>,
|
|
<directive module="mod_authn_dbm">AuthDBMUserFile</directive>,
|
|
<directive module="mod_authz_groupfile">AuthGroupFile</directive>,
|
|
<directive module="mod_authn_core">AuthName</directive>,
|
|
<directive module="mod_authn_core">AuthType</directive>, <directive
|
|
module="mod_authn_file">AuthUserFile</directive>, <directive
|
|
module="mod_authz_core">Require</directive>, <em>etc.</em>).</dd>
|
|
|
|
<dt><a href="overrides.html#override-fileinfo">FileInfo</a></dt>
|
|
|
|
<dd>
|
|
Allow use of the directives controlling document types
|
|
(<directive module="core">ErrorDocument</directive>,
|
|
<directive module="core">ForceType</directive>,
|
|
<directive module="mod_negotiation">LanguagePriority</directive>,
|
|
<directive module="core">SetHandler</directive>,
|
|
<directive module="core">SetInputFilter</directive>,
|
|
<directive module="core">SetOutputFilter</directive>, and
|
|
<module>mod_mime</module> Add* and Remove* directives),
|
|
document meta data (<directive
|
|
module="mod_headers">Header</directive>, <directive
|
|
module="mod_headers">RequestHeader</directive>, <directive
|
|
module="mod_setenvif">SetEnvIf</directive>, <directive
|
|
module="mod_setenvif">SetEnvIfNoCase</directive>, <directive
|
|
module="mod_setenvif">BrowserMatch</directive>, <directive
|
|
module="mod_usertrack">CookieExpires</directive>, <directive
|
|
module="mod_usertrack">CookieDomain</directive>, <directive
|
|
module="mod_usertrack">CookieStyle</directive>, <directive
|
|
module="mod_usertrack">CookieTracking</directive>, <directive
|
|
module="mod_usertrack">CookieName</directive>),
|
|
<module>mod_rewrite</module> directives (<directive
|
|
module="mod_rewrite">RewriteEngine</directive>, <directive
|
|
module="mod_rewrite">RewriteOptions</directive>, <directive
|
|
module="mod_rewrite">RewriteBase</directive>, <directive
|
|
module="mod_rewrite">RewriteCond</directive>, <directive
|
|
module="mod_rewrite">RewriteRule</directive>),
|
|
<module>mod_alias</module> directives (<directive
|
|
module="mod_alias">Redirect</directive>, <directive
|
|
module="mod_alias">RedirectTemp</directive>, <directive
|
|
module="mod_alias">RedirectPermanent</directive>, <directive
|
|
module="mod_alias">RedirectMatch</directive>), and
|
|
<directive module="mod_actions">Action</directive> from
|
|
<module>mod_actions</module>.
|
|
</dd>
|
|
|
|
<dt><a href="overrides.html#override-indexes">Indexes</a></dt>
|
|
|
|
<dd>
|
|
Allow use of the directives controlling directory indexing
|
|
(<directive
|
|
module="mod_autoindex">AddDescription</directive>,
|
|
<directive module="mod_autoindex">AddIcon</directive>, <directive
|
|
module="mod_autoindex">AddIconByEncoding</directive>,
|
|
<directive module="mod_autoindex">AddIconByType</directive>,
|
|
<directive module="mod_autoindex">DefaultIcon</directive>, <directive
|
|
module="mod_dir">DirectoryIndex</directive>, <directive
|
|
module="mod_dir">FallbackResource</directive>, <a href="mod_autoindex.html#indexoptions.fancyindexing"
|
|
><code>FancyIndexing</code></a>, <directive
|
|
module="mod_autoindex">HeaderName</directive>, <directive
|
|
module="mod_autoindex">IndexIgnore</directive>, <directive
|
|
module="mod_autoindex">IndexOptions</directive>, <directive
|
|
module="mod_autoindex">ReadmeName</directive>,
|
|
<em>etc.</em>).</dd>
|
|
|
|
<dt><a href="overrides.html#override-limit">Limit</a></dt>
|
|
|
|
<dd>
|
|
Allow use of the directives controlling host access (<directive
|
|
module="mod_access_compat">Allow</directive>, <directive
|
|
module="mod_access_compat">Deny</directive> and <directive
|
|
module="mod_access_compat">Order</directive>).</dd>
|
|
|
|
<!-- TODO - Update this for 2.4 syntax -->
|
|
|
|
|
|
<dt>Nonfatal=[Override|Unknown|All]</dt>
|
|
|
|
<dd>
|
|
Allow use of AllowOverride option to treat invalid (unrecognized
|
|
or disallowed) directives in
|
|
.htaccess as nonfatal. Instead of causing an Internal Server
|
|
Error, disallowed or unrecognised directives will be ignored
|
|
and a warning logged:
|
|
<ul>
|
|
<li><strong>Nonfatal=Override</strong> treats directives
|
|
forbidden by AllowOverride as nonfatal.</li>
|
|
<li><strong>Nonfatal=Unknown</strong> treats unknown directives
|
|
as nonfatal. This covers typos and directives implemented
|
|
by a module that's not present.</li>
|
|
<li><strong>Nonfatal=All</strong> treats both the above as nonfatal.</li>
|
|
</ul>
|
|
<p>Note that a syntax error in a valid directive will still cause
|
|
an Internal Server Error.</p>
|
|
<note type="warning"><title>Security</title>
|
|
Nonfatal errors may have security implications for .htaccess users.
|
|
For example, if AllowOverride disallows AuthConfig, users'
|
|
configuration designed to restrict access to a site will be disabled.
|
|
</note>
|
|
</dd>
|
|
|
|
<dt><a href="overrides.html#override-options">Options</a>[=<var>Option</var>,...]</dt>
|
|
|
|
<dd>
|
|
Allow use of the directives controlling specific directory
|
|
features (<directive module="core">Options</directive> and
|
|
<directive module="mod_include">XBitHack</directive>).
|
|
An equal sign may be given followed by a comma-separated list, without
|
|
spaces, of options that may be set using the <directive
|
|
module="core">Options</directive> command.
|
|
|
|
<note><title>Implicit disabling of Options</title>
|
|
<p>Even though the list of options that may be used in .htaccess files
|
|
can be limited with this directive, as long as any <directive
|
|
module="core">Options</directive> directive is allowed any
|
|
other inherited option can be disabled by using the non-relative
|
|
syntax. In other words, this mechanism cannot force a specific option
|
|
to remain <em>set</em> while allowing any others to be set.
|
|
</p></note>
|
|
|
|
<example>
|
|
AllowOverride Options=Indexes,MultiViews
|
|
</example>
|
|
</dd>
|
|
</dl>
|
|
|
|
<p>Example:</p>
|
|
|
|
<highlight language="config">
|
|
AllowOverride AuthConfig Indexes
|
|
</highlight>
|
|
|
|
<p>In the example above, all directives that are neither in the group
|
|
<code>AuthConfig</code> nor <code>Indexes</code> cause an internal
|
|
server error.</p>
|
|
|
|
<note><p>For security and performance reasons, do not set
|
|
<code>AllowOverride</code> to anything other than <code>None</code>
|
|
in your <code><Directory "/"></code> block. Instead, find (or
|
|
create) the <code><Directory></code> block that refers to the
|
|
directory where you're actually planning to place a
|
|
<code>.htaccess</code> file.</p>
|
|
</note>
|
|
</usage>

<directivesynopsis type="section">
|
|
<name>Directory</name>
|
|
<description>Enclose a group of directives that apply only to the
|
|
named file-system directory, sub-directories, and their contents.</description>
|
|
<syntax><Directory <var>directory-path</var>>
|
|
... </Directory></syntax>
|
|
<contextlist><context>server config</context><context>virtual host</context>
|
|
</contextlist>
|
|
|
|
<usage>
|
|
<p><directive type="section">Directory</directive> and
|
|
<code></Directory></code> are used to enclose a group of
|
|
directives that will apply only to the named directory,
|
|
sub-directories of that directory, and the files within the respective
|
|
directories. Any directive that is allowed
|
|
in a directory context may be used. <var>Directory-path</var> is
|
|
either the full path to a directory, or a wild-card string using
|
|
Unix shell-style matching. In a wild-card string, <code>?</code> matches
|
|
any single character, and <code>*</code> matches any sequences of
|
|
characters. You may also use <code>[]</code> character ranges. None
|
|
of the wildcards match a `/' character, so <code><Directory
|
|
"/*/public_html"></code> will not match
|
|
<code>/home/user/public_html</code>, but <code><Directory
|
|
"/home/*/public_html"></code> will match. Example:</p>
|
|
|
|
<highlight language="config">
|
|
<Directory "/usr/local/httpd/htdocs">
|
|
Options Indexes FollowSymLinks
|
|
</Directory>
|
|
</highlight>
|
|
|
|
<p>Directory paths <em>may</em> be quoted, if you like, however, it
|
|
<em>must</em> be quoted if the path contains spaces. This is because a
|
|
space would otherwise indicate the end of an argument.</p>
|
|
|
|
<note>
|
|
<p>Be careful with the <var>directory-path</var> arguments:
|
|
They have to literally match the filesystem path which Apache httpd uses
|
|
to access the files. Directives applied to a particular
|
|
<code><Directory></code> will not apply to files accessed from
|
|
that same directory via a different path, such as via different symbolic
|
|
links.</p>
|
|
</note>
|
|
|
|
<p><glossary ref="regex">Regular
|
|
expressions</glossary> can also be used, with the addition of the
|
|
<code>~</code> character. For example:</p>
|
|
|
|
<highlight language="config">
|
|
<Directory ~ "^/www/[0-9]{3}">
|
|
|
|
</Directory>
|
|
</highlight>
|
|
|
|
<p>would match directories in <code>/www/</code> that consisted of
|
|
three numbers.</p>
|
|
|
|
<p>If multiple (non-regular expression) <directive
|
|
type="section">Directory</directive> sections
|
|
match the directory (or one of its parents) containing a document,
|
|
then the directives are applied in the order of shortest match
|
|
first, interspersed with the directives from the <a
|
|
href="#accessfilename">.htaccess</a> files. For example,
|
|
with</p>
|
|
|
|
<highlight language="config">
|
|
<Directory "/">
|
|
AllowOverride None
|
|
</Directory>
|
|
|
|
<Directory "/home">
|
|
AllowOverride FileInfo
|
|
</Directory>
|
|
</highlight>
|
|
|
|
<p>for access to the document <code>/home/web/dir/doc.html</code>
|
|
the steps are:</p>
|
|
|
|
<ul>
|
|
<li>Apply directive <code>AllowOverride None</code>
|
|
(disabling <code>.htaccess</code> files).</li>
|
|
|
|
<li>Apply directive <code>AllowOverride FileInfo</code> (for
|
|
directory <code>/home</code>).</li>
|
|
|
|
<li>Apply any <code>FileInfo</code> directives in
|
|
<code>/home/.htaccess</code>, <code>/home/web/.htaccess</code> and
|
|
<code>/home/web/dir/.htaccess</code> in that order.</li>
|
|
</ul>
|
|
|
|
<p>Regular expressions are not considered until after all of the
|
|
normal sections have been applied. Then all of the regular
|
|
expressions are tested in the order they appeared in the
|
|
configuration file. For example, with</p>
|
|
|
|
<highlight language="config">
|
|
<Directory ~ "abc$">
|
|
# ... directives here ...
|
|
</Directory>
|
|
</highlight>
|
|
|
|
<p>the regular expression section won't be considered until after
|
|
all normal <directive type="section">Directory</directive>s and
|
|
<code>.htaccess</code> files have been applied. Then the regular
|
|
expression will match on <code>/home/abc/public_html/abc</code> and
|
|
the corresponding <directive type="section">Directory</directive> will
|
|
be applied.</p>
|
|
|
|
<p><strong>Note that the default access for
|
|
<code><Directory "/"></code> is to permit all access.
|
|
This means that Apache httpd will serve any file mapped from an URL. It is
|
|
recommended that you change this with a block such
|
|
as</strong></p>
|
|
|
|
<highlight language="config">
|
|
<Directory "/">
|
|
Require all denied
|
|
</Directory>
|
|
</highlight>
|
|
|
|
<p><strong>and then override this for directories you
|
|
<em>want</em> accessible. See the <a
|
|
href="../misc/security_tips.html">Security Tips</a> page for more
|
|
details.</strong></p>
|
|
|
|
<p>The directory sections occur in the <code>httpd.conf</code> file.
|
|
<directive type="section">Directory</directive> directives
|
|
cannot nest, and cannot appear in a <directive module="core"
|
|
type="section">Limit</directive> or <directive module="core"
|
|
type="section">LimitExcept</directive> section.</p>
|
|
</usage>

<directivesynopsis>
|
|
<name>HttpProtocolOptions</name>
|
|
<description>Modify restrictions on HTTP Request Messages</description>
|
|
<syntax>HttpProtocolOptions [Strict|Unsafe] [RegisteredMethods|LenientMethods]
|
|
[Allow0.9|Require1.0]</syntax>
|
|
<default>HttpProtocolOptions Strict LenientMethods Allow0.9</default>
|
|
<contextlist><context>server config</context>
|
|
<context>virtual host</context></contextlist>
|
|
<compatibility>2.2.32 or 2.4.24 and later</compatibility>
|
|
|
|
<usage>
|
|
<p>This directive changes the rules applied to the HTTP Request Line
|
|
(<a href="https://tools.ietf.org/html/rfc7230#section-3.1.1"
|
|
>RFC 7230 §3.1.1</a>) and the HTTP Request Header Fields
|
|
(<a href="https://tools.ietf.org/html/rfc7230#section-3.2"
|
|
>RFC 7230 §3.2</a>), which are now applied by default or using
|
|
the <code>Strict</code> option. Due to legacy modules, applications or
|
|
custom user-agents which must be deprecated the <code>Unsafe</code>
|
|
option has been added to revert to the legacy behaviors.</p>
|
|
|
|
<p>These rules are applied prior to request processing,
|
|
so must be configured at the global or default (first) matching
|
|
virtual host section, by IP/port interface (and not by name)
|
|
to be honored.</p>
|
|
|
|
<p>The directive accepts three parameters from the following list
|
|
of choices, applying the default to the ones not specified:</p>
|
|
|
|
<dl>
|
|
<dt>Strict|Unsafe</dt>
|
|
<dd>
|
|
<p>Prior to the introduction of this directive, the Apache HTTP Server
|
|
request message parsers were tolerant of a number of forms of input
|
|
which did not conform to the protocol.
|
|
<a href="https://tools.ietf.org/html/rfc7230#section-9.4"
|
|
>RFC 7230 §9.4 Request Splitting</a> and
|
|
<a href="https://tools.ietf.org/html/rfc7230#section-9.5"
|
|
>§9.5 Response Smuggling</a> call out only two of the potential
|
|
risks of accepting non-conformant request messages, while
|
|
<a href="https://tools.ietf.org/html/rfc7230#section-3.5"
|
|
>RFC 7230 §3.5</a> "Message Parsing Robustness" identify the
|
|
risks of accepting obscure whitespace and request message formatting.
|
|
As of the introduction of this directive, all grammar rules of the
|
|
specification are enforced in the default <code>Strict</code> operating
|
|
mode, and the strict whitespace suggested by section 3.5 is enforced
|
|
and cannot be relaxed.</p>
|
|
|
|
<note type="warning"><title>Security risks of Unsafe</title>
|
|
<p>Users are strongly cautioned against toggling the <code>Unsafe</code>
|
|
mode of operation, particularly on outward-facing, publicly accessible
|
|
server deployments. If an interface is required for faulty monitoring
|
|
or other custom service consumers running on an intranet, users should
|
|
toggle the Unsafe option only on a specific virtual host configured
|
|
to service their internal private network.</p>
|
|
</note>
|
|
|
|
<example>
|
|
<title>Example of a request leading to HTTP 400 with Strict mode</title>
|
|
# Missing CRLF<br />
|
|
GET / HTTP/1.0\n\n
|
|
</example>
|
|
<note type="warning"><title>Command line tools and CRLF</title>
|
|
<p>Some tools need to be forced to use CRLF, otherwise httpd will return
|
|
a HTTP 400 response like described in the above use case. For example,
|
|
the <strong>OpenSSL s_client needs the -crlf parameter to work
|
|
properly</strong>.</p>
|
|
<p>The <directive module="mod_dumpio">DumpIOInput</directive> directive
|
|
can help while reviewing the HTTP request to identify issues like the
|
|
absence of CRLF.</p>
|
|
</note>
|
|
</dd>
|
|
<dt>RegisteredMethods|LenientMethods</dt>
|
|
<dd>
|
|
<p><a href="https://tools.ietf.org/html/rfc7231#section-4.1"
|
|
>RFC 7231 §4.1</a> "Request Methods" "Overview" requires that
|
|
origin servers shall respond with a HTTP 501 status code when an
|
|
unsupported method is encountered in the request line.
|
|
This already happens when the <code>LenientMethods</code> option is used,
|
|
but administrators may wish to toggle the <code>RegisteredMethods</code>
|
|
option and register any non-standard methods using the
|
|
<directive module="core">RegisterHttpMethod</directive>
|
|
directive, particularly if the <code>Unsafe</code>
|
|
option has been toggled.</p>
|
|
|
|
<note type="warning"><title>Forward Proxy compatibility</title>
|
|
<p>The <code>RegisteredMethods</code> option should <strong>not</strong>
|
|
be toggled for forward proxy hosts, as the methods supported by the
|
|
origin servers are unknown to the proxy server.</p>
|
|
</note>
|
|
|
|
<example>
|
|
<title>Example of a request leading to HTTP 501 with LenientMethods mode</title>
|
|
# Unknown HTTP method<br />
|
|
WOW / HTTP/1.0\r\n\r\n<br /><br />
|
|
# Lowercase HTTP method<br />
|
|
get / HTTP/1.0\r\n\r\n<br />
|
|
</example>
|
|
</dd>
|
|
<dt>Allow0.9|Require1.0</dt>
|
|
<dd>
|
|
<p><a href="https://tools.ietf.org/html/rfc2616#section-19.6"
|
|
>RFC 2616 §19.6</a> "Compatibility With Previous Versions" had
|
|
encouraged HTTP servers to support legacy HTTP/0.9 requests. RFC 7230
|
|
supersedes this with "The expectation to support HTTP/0.9 requests has
|
|
been removed" and offers additional comments in
|
|
<a href="https://tools.ietf.org/html/rfc7230#appendix-A"
|
|
>RFC 7230 Appendix A</a>. The <code>Require1.0</code> option allows
|
|
the user to remove support of the default <code>Allow0.9</code> option's
|
|
behavior.</p>
|
|
|
|
<example>
|
|
<title>Example of a request leading to HTTP 400 with Require1.0 mode</title>
|
|
# Unsupported HTTP version<br />
|
|
GET /\r\n\r\n
|
|
</example>
|
|
</dd>
|
|
</dl>
|
|
<p>Reviewing the messages logged to the
|
|
<directive module="core">ErrorLog</directive>, configured with
|
|
<directive module="core">LogLevel</directive> <code>debug</code> level,
|
|
can help identify such faulty requests along with their origin.
|
|
Users should pay particular attention to the 400 responses in the access
|
|
log for invalid requests which were unexpectedly rejected.</p>
|
|
</usage>

<directivesynopsis>
|
|
<name>ErrorDocument</name>
|
|
<description>What the server will return to the client
|
|
in case of an error</description>
|
|
<syntax>ErrorDocument <var>error-code</var> <var>document</var></syntax>
|
|
<contextlist><context>server config</context><context>virtual host</context>
|
|
<context>directory</context><context>.htaccess</context>
|
|
</contextlist>
|
|
<override>FileInfo</override>
|
|
|
|
<usage>
|
|
<p>In the event of a problem or error, Apache httpd can be configured
|
|
to do one of four things,</p>
|
|
|
|
<ol>
|
|
<li>output a simple hardcoded error message</li>
|
|
|
|
<li>output a customized message</li>
|
|
|
|
<li>internally redirect to a local <var>URL-path</var> to handle the
|
|
problem/error</li>
|
|
|
|
<li>redirect to an external <var>URL</var> to handle the
|
|
problem/error</li>
|
|
</ol>
|
|
|
|
<p>The first option is the default, while options 2-4 are
|
|
configured using the <directive>ErrorDocument</directive>
|
|
directive, which is followed by the HTTP response code and a URL
|
|
or a message. Apache httpd will sometimes offer additional information
|
|
regarding the problem/error.</p>
|
|
|
|
<p>From 2.4.13, <a href="../expr.html">expression syntax</a> can be
|
|
used inside the directive to produce dynamic strings and URLs.</p>
|
|
|
|
<p>URLs can begin with a slash (/) for local web-paths (relative
|
|
to the <directive module="core">DocumentRoot</directive>), or be a
|
|
full URL which the client can resolve. Alternatively, a message
|
|
can be provided to be displayed by the browser. Note that deciding
|
|
whether the parameter is an URL, a path or a message is performed
|
|
before any expression is parsed. Examples:</p>
|
|
|
|
<highlight language="config">
|
|
ErrorDocument 500 http://example.com/cgi-bin/server-error.cgi
|
|
ErrorDocument 404 /errors/bad_urls.php
|
|
ErrorDocument 401 /subscription_info.html
|
|
ErrorDocument 403 "Sorry, can't allow you access today"
|
|
ErrorDocument 403 Forbidden!
|
|
ErrorDocument 403 /errors/forbidden.py?referrer=%{escape:%{HTTP_REFERER}}
|
|
</highlight>
|
|
|
|
<p>Additionally, the special value <code>default</code> can be used
|
|
to specify Apache httpd's simple hardcoded message. While not required
|
|
under normal circumstances, <code>default</code> will restore
|
|
Apache httpd's simple hardcoded message for configurations that would
|
|
otherwise inherit an existing <directive>ErrorDocument</directive>.</p>
|
|
|
|
<highlight language="config">
|
|
ErrorDocument 404 /cgi-bin/bad_urls.pl
|
|
|
|
<Directory "/web/docs">
|
|
ErrorDocument 404 default
|
|
</Directory>
|
|
</highlight>
|
|
|
|
<p>Note that when you specify an <directive>ErrorDocument</directive>
|
|
that points to a remote URL (ie. anything with a method such as
|
|
<code>http</code> in front of it), Apache HTTP Server will send a redirect to the
|
|
client to tell it where to find the document, even if the
|
|
document ends up being on the same server. This has several
|
|
implications, the most important being that the client will not
|
|
receive the original error status code, but instead will
|
|
receive a redirect status code. This in turn can confuse web
|
|
robots and other clients which try to determine if a URL is
|
|
valid using the status code. In addition, if you use a remote
|
|
URL in an <code>ErrorDocument 401</code>, the client will not
|
|
know to prompt the user for a password since it will not
|
|
receive the 401 status code. Therefore, <strong>if you use an
|
|
<code>ErrorDocument 401</code> directive, then it must refer to a local
|
|
document.</strong></p>
|
|
|
|
<p>Microsoft Internet Explorer (MSIE) will by default ignore
|
|
server-generated error messages when they are "too small" and substitute
|
|
its own "friendly" error messages. The size threshold varies depending on
|
|
the type of error, but in general, if you make your error document
|
|
greater than 512 bytes, then MSIE will show the server-generated
|
|
error rather than masking it. More information is available in
|
|
Microsoft Knowledge Base article <a
|
|
href="http://support.microsoft.com/default.aspx?scid=kb;en-us;Q294807"
|
|
>Q294807</a>.</p>
|
|
|
|
<p>Although most error messages can be overridden, there are certain
|
|
circumstances where the internal messages are used regardless of the
|
|
setting of <directive module="core">ErrorDocument</directive>. In
|
|
particular, if a malformed request is detected, normal request processing
|
|
will be immediately halted and the internal error message returned.
|
|
This is necessary to guard against security problems caused by
|
|
bad requests.</p>
|
|
|
|
<p>If you are using mod_proxy, you may wish to enable
|
|
<directive module="mod_proxy">ProxyErrorOverride</directive> so that you can provide
|
|
custom error messages on behalf of your Origin servers. If you don't enable ProxyErrorOverride,
|
|
Apache httpd will not generate custom error documents for proxied content.</p>
|
|
</usage>

<directivesynopsis>
|
|
<name>ErrorLogFormat</name>
|
|
<description>Format specification for error log entries</description>
|
|
<syntax> ErrorLogFormat [connection|request] <var>format</var></syntax>
|
|
<contextlist><context>server config</context><context>virtual host</context>
|
|
</contextlist>
|
|
|
|
<usage>
|
|
<p><directive>ErrorLogFormat</directive> allows to specify what
|
|
supplementary information is logged in the error log in addition to the
|
|
actual log message.</p>
|
|
|
|
<highlight language="config">
|
|
#Simple example
|
|
ErrorLogFormat "[%t] [%l] [pid %P] %F: %E: [client %a] %M"
|
|
</highlight>
|
|
|
|
<p>Specifying <code>connection</code> or <code>request</code> as first
|
|
parameter allows to specify additional formats, causing additional
|
|
information to be logged when the first message is logged for a specific
|
|
connection or request, respectively. This additional information is only
|
|
logged once per connection/request. If a connection or request is processed
|
|
without causing any log message, the additional information is not logged
|
|
either.</p>
|
|
|
|
<p>It can happen that some format string items do not produce output. For
|
|
example, the Referer header is only present if the log message is
|
|
associated to a request and the log message happens at a time when the
|
|
Referer header has already been read from the client. If no output is
|
|
produced, the default behavior is to delete everything from the preceding
|
|
space character to the next space character. This means the log line is
|
|
implicitly divided into fields on non-whitespace to whitespace transitions.
|
|
If a format string item does not produce output, the whole field is
|
|
omitted. For example, if the remote address <code>%a</code> in the log
|
|
format <code>[%t] [%l] [%a] %M </code> is not available, the surrounding
|
|
brackets are not logged either. Space characters can be escaped with a
|
|
backslash to prevent them from delimiting a field. The combination '% '
|
|
(percent space) is a zero-width field delimiter that does not produce any
|
|
output.</p>
|
|
|
|
<p>The above behavior can be changed by adding modifiers to the format
|
|
string item. A <code>-</code> (minus) modifier causes a minus to be logged if the
|
|
respective item does not produce any output. In once-per-connection/request
|
|
formats, it is also possible to use the <code>+</code> (plus) modifier. If an
|
|
item with the plus modifier does not produce any output, the whole line is
|
|
omitted.</p>
|
|
|
|
<p>A number as modifier can be used to assign a log severity level to a
|
|
format item. The item will only be logged if the severity of the log
|
|
message is not higher than the specified log severity level. The number can
|
|
range from 1 (alert) over 4 (warn) and 7 (debug) to 15 (trace8).</p>
|
|
|
|
<p>For example, here's what would happen if you added modifiers to
|
|
the <code>%{Referer}i</code> token, which logs the
|
|
<code>Referer</code> request header.</p>
|
|
|
|
<table border="1" style="zebra">
|
|
<columnspec><column width=".3"/><column width=".7"/></columnspec>
|
|
|
|
<tr><th>Modified Token</th><th>Meaning</th></tr>
|
|
|
|
<tr>
|
|
<td><code>%-{Referer}i</code></td>
|
|
<td>Logs a <code>-</code> if <code>Referer</code> is not set.</td>
|
|
</tr>
|
|
|
|
<tr>
|
|
<td><code>%+{Referer}i</code></td>
|
|
<td>Omits the entire line if <code>Referer</code> is not set.</td>
|
|
</tr>
|
|
|
|
<tr>
|
|
<td><code>%4{Referer}i</code></td>
|
|
<td>Logs the <code>Referer</code> only if the log message severity
|
|
is higher than 4.</td>
|
|
</tr>
|
|
|
|
</table>
|
|
|
|
<p>Some format string items accept additional parameters in braces.</p>
|
|
|
|
<table border="1" style="zebra">
|
|
<columnspec><column width=".2"/><column width=".8"/></columnspec>
|
|
|
|
<tr><th>Format String</th> <th>Description</th></tr>
|
|
|
|
<tr><td><code>%%</code></td>
|
|
<td>The percent sign</td></tr>
|
|
|
|
<tr><td><code>%a</code></td>
|
|
<td>Client IP address and port of the request</td></tr>
|
|
|
|
<tr><td><code>%{c}a</code></td>
|
|
<td>Underlying peer IP address and port of the connection (see the
|
|
<module>mod_remoteip</module> module)</td></tr>
|
|
|
|
<tr><td><code>%A</code></td>
|
|
<td>Local IP-address and port</td></tr>
|
|
|
|
<tr><td><code>%{<em>name</em>}e</code></td>
|
|
<td>Request environment variable <em>name</em></td></tr>
|
|
|
|
<tr><td><code>%E</code></td>
|
|
<td>APR/OS error status code and string</td></tr>
|
|
|
|
<tr><td><code>%F</code></td>
|
|
<td>Source file name and line number of the log call</td></tr>
|
|
|
|
<tr><td><code>%{<em>name</em>}i</code></td>
|
|
<td>Request header <em>name</em></td></tr>
|
|
|
|
<tr><td><code>%k</code></td>
|
|
<td>Number of keep-alive requests on this connection</td></tr>
|
|
|
|
<tr><td><code>%l</code></td>
|
|
<td>Loglevel of the message</td></tr>
|
|
|
|
<tr><td><code>%L</code></td>
|
|
<td>Log ID of the request</td></tr>
|
|
|
|
<tr><td><code>%{c}L</code></td>
|
|
<td>Log ID of the connection</td></tr>
|
|
|
|
<tr><td><code>%{C}L</code></td>
|
|
<td>Log ID of the connection if used in connection scope, empty otherwise</td></tr>
|
|
|
|
<tr><td><code>%m</code></td>
|
|
<td>Name of the module logging the message</td></tr>
|
|
|
|
<tr><td><code>%M</code></td>
|
|
<td>The actual log message</td></tr>
|
|
|
|
<tr><td><code>%{<em>name</em>}n</code></td>
|
|
<td>Request note <em>name</em></td></tr>
|
|
|
|
<tr><td><code>%P</code></td>
|
|
<td>Process ID of current process</td></tr>
|
|
|
|
<tr><td><code>%T</code></td>
|
|
<td>Thread ID of current thread</td></tr>
|
|
|
|
<tr><td><code>%{g}T</code></td>
|
|
<td>System unique thread ID of current thread (the same ID as
|
|
displayed by e.g. <code>top</code>; currently Linux only)</td></tr>
|
|
|
|
<tr><td><code>%t</code></td>
|
|
<td>The current time</td></tr>
|
|
|
|
<tr><td><code>%{u}t</code></td>
|
|
<td>The current time including micro-seconds</td></tr>
|
|
|
|
<tr><td><code>%{cu}t</code></td>
|
|
<td>The current time in compact ISO 8601 format, including
|
|
micro-seconds</td></tr>
|
|
|
|
<tr><td><code>%v</code></td>
|
|
<td>The canonical <directive module="core">ServerName</directive>
|
|
of the current server.</td></tr>
|
|
|
|
<tr><td><code>%V</code></td>
|
|
<td>The server name of the server serving the request according to the
|
|
<directive module="core" >UseCanonicalName</directive>
|
|
setting.</td></tr>
|
|
|
|
<tr><td><code>\ </code> (backslash space)</td>
|
|
<td>Non-field delimiting space</td></tr>
|
|
|
|
<tr><td><code>% </code> (percent space)</td>
|
|
<td>Field delimiter (no output)</td></tr>
|
|
</table>
|
|
|
|
<p>The log ID format <code>%L</code> produces a unique id for a connection
|
|
or request. This can be used to correlate which log lines belong to the
|
|
same connection or request, which request happens on which connection.
|
|
A <code>%L</code> format string is also available in
|
|
<module>mod_log_config</module> to allow to correlate access log entries
|
|
with error log lines. If <module>mod_unique_id</module> is loaded, its
|
|
unique id will be used as log ID for requests.</p>
|
|
|
|
<highlight language="config">
|
|
#Example (default format for threaded MPMs)
|
|
ErrorLogFormat "[%{u}t] [%-m:%l] [pid %P:tid %T] %7F: %E: [client\ %a] %M% ,\ referer\ %{Referer}i"
|
|
</highlight>
|
|
|
|
<p>This would result in error messages such as:</p>
|
|
|
|
<example>
|
|
[Thu May 12 08:28:57.652118 2011] [core:error] [pid 8777:tid 4326490112] [client ::1:58619] File does not exist: /usr/local/apache2/htdocs/favicon.ico
|
|
</example>
|
|
|
|
<p>Notice that, as discussed above, some fields are omitted
|
|
entirely because they are not defined.</p>
|
|
|
|
<highlight language="config">
|
|
#Example (similar to the 2.2.x format)
|
|
ErrorLogFormat "[%t] [%l] %7F: %E: [client\ %a] %M% ,\ referer\ %{Referer}i"
|
|
</highlight>
|
|
|
|
<highlight language="config">
|
|
#Advanced example with request/connection log IDs
|
|
ErrorLogFormat "[%{uc}t] [%-m:%-l] [R:%L] [C:%{C}L] %7F: %E: %M"
|
|
ErrorLogFormat request "[%{uc}t] [R:%L] Request %k on C:%{c}L pid:%P tid:%T"
|
|
ErrorLogFormat request "[%{uc}t] [R:%L] UA:'%+{User-Agent}i'"
|
|
ErrorLogFormat request "[%{uc}t] [R:%L] Referer:'%+{Referer}i'"
|
|
ErrorLogFormat connection "[%{uc}t] [C:%{c}L] local\ %a remote\ %A"
|
|
</highlight>
|
|
|
|
</usage>

<directivesynopsis type="section">
|
|
<name>Limit</name>
|
|
<description>Restrict enclosed access controls to only certain HTTP
|
|
methods</description>
|
|
<syntax><Limit <var>method</var> [<var>method</var>] ... > ...
|
|
</Limit></syntax>
|
|
<contextlist><context>directory</context><context>.htaccess</context>
|
|
</contextlist>
|
|
<override>AuthConfig, Limit</override>
|
|
|
|
<usage>
|
|
<p>Access controls are normally effective for
|
|
<strong>all</strong> access methods, and this is the usual
|
|
desired behavior. <strong>In the general case, access control
|
|
directives should not be placed within a
|
|
<directive type="section">Limit</directive> section.</strong></p>
|
|
|
|
<p>The purpose of the <directive type="section">Limit</directive>
|
|
directive is to restrict the effect of the access controls to the
|
|
nominated HTTP methods. For all other methods, the access
|
|
restrictions that are enclosed in the <directive
|
|
type="section">Limit</directive> bracket <strong>will have no
|
|
effect</strong>. The following example applies the access control
|
|
only to the methods <code>POST</code>, <code>PUT</code>, and
|
|
<code>DELETE</code>, leaving all other methods unprotected:</p>
|
|
|
|
<highlight language="config">
|
|
<Limit POST PUT DELETE>
|
|
Require valid-user
|
|
</Limit>
|
|
</highlight>
|
|
|
|
<p>The method names listed can be one or more of: <code>GET</code>,
|
|
<code>POST</code>, <code>PUT</code>, <code>DELETE</code>,
|
|
<code>CONNECT</code>, <code>OPTIONS</code>,
|
|
<code>PATCH</code>, <code>PROPFIND</code>, <code>PROPPATCH</code>,
|
|
<code>MKCOL</code>, <code>COPY</code>, <code>MOVE</code>,
|
|
<code>LOCK</code>, and <code>UNLOCK</code>. <strong>The method name is
|
|
case-sensitive.</strong> If <code>GET</code> is used, it will also
|
|
restrict <code>HEAD</code> requests. The <code>TRACE</code> method
|
|
cannot be limited (see <directive module="core"
|
|
>TraceEnable</directive>).</p>
|
|
|
|
<note type="warning">A <directive type="section"
|
|
module="core">LimitExcept</directive> section should always be
|
|
used in preference to a <directive type="section">Limit</directive>
|
|
section when restricting access, since a <directive type="section"
|
|
module="core">LimitExcept</directive> section provides protection
|
|
against arbitrary methods.</note>
|
|
|
|
<p>The <directive type="section">Limit</directive> and
|
|
<directive type="section" module="core">LimitExcept</directive>
|
|
directives may be nested. In this case, each successive level of
|
|
<directive type="section">Limit</directive> or <directive
|
|
type="section" module="core">LimitExcept</directive> directives must
|
|
further restrict the set of methods to which access controls apply.</p>
|
|
|
|
<note type="warning">When using
|
|
<directive type="section">Limit</directive> or
|
|
<directive type="section">LimitExcept</directive> directives with
|
|
the <directive module="mod_authz_core">Require</directive> directive,
|
|
note that the first <directive module="mod_authz_core">Require</directive>
|
|
to succeed authorizes the request, regardless of the presence of other
|
|
<directive module="mod_authz_core">Require</directive> directives.</note>
|
|
|
|
<p>For example, given the following configuration, all users will
|
|
be authorized for <code>POST</code> requests, and the
|
|
<code>Require group editors</code> directive will be ignored
|
|
in all cases:</p>
|
|
|
|
<highlight language="config">
|
|
<LimitExcept GET>
|
|
Require valid-user
|
|
</LimitExcept>
|
|
<Limit POST>
|
|
Require group editors
|
|
</Limit>
|
|
</highlight>
|
|
</usage>

<directivesynopsis type="section">
|
|
<name>Location</name>
|
|
<description>Applies the enclosed directives only to matching
|
|
URLs</description>
|
|
<syntax><Location
|
|
<var>URL-path</var>|<var>URL</var>> ... </Location></syntax>
|
|
<contextlist><context>server config</context><context>virtual host</context>
|
|
</contextlist>
|
|
|
|
<usage>
|
|
<p>The <directive type="section">Location</directive> directive
|
|
limits the scope of the enclosed directives by URL. It is similar to the
|
|
<directive type="section" module="core">Directory</directive>
|
|
directive, and starts a subsection which is terminated with a
|
|
<code></Location></code> directive. <directive
|
|
type="section">Location</directive> sections are processed in the
|
|
order they appear in the configuration file, after the <directive
|
|
type="section" module="core">Directory</directive> sections and
|
|
<code>.htaccess</code> files are read, and after the <directive
|
|
type="section" module="core">Files</directive> sections.</p>
|
|
|
|
<p><directive type="section">Location</directive> sections operate
|
|
completely outside the filesystem. This has several consequences.
|
|
Most importantly, <directive type="section">Location</directive>
|
|
directives should not be used to control access to filesystem
|
|
locations. Since several different URLs may map to the same
|
|
filesystem location, such access controls may by circumvented.</p>
|
|
|
|
<p>The enclosed directives will be applied to the request if the path component
|
|
of the URL meets <em>any</em> of the following criteria:
|
|
</p>
|
|
<ul>
|
|
<li>The specified location matches exactly the path component of the URL.
|
|
</li>
|
|
<li>The specified location, which ends in a forward slash, is a prefix
|
|
of the path component of the URL (treated as a context root).
|
|
</li>
|
|
<li>The specified location, with the addition of a trailing slash, is a
|
|
prefix of the path component of the URL (also treated as a context root).
|
|
</li>
|
|
</ul>
|
|
<p>
|
|
In the example below, where no trailing slash is used, requests to
|
|
/private1, /private1/ and /private1/file.txt will have the enclosed
|
|
directives applied, but /private1other would not.
|
|
</p>
|
|
<highlight language="config">
|
|
<Location "/private1">
|
|
# ...
|
|
</Location>
|
|
</highlight>
|
|
<p>
|
|
In the example below, where a trailing slash is used, requests to
|
|
/private2/ and /private2/file.txt will have the enclosed
|
|
directives applied, but /private2 and /private2other would not.
|
|
</p>
|
|
<highlight language="config">
|
|
<Location "/private2<em>/</em>">
|
|
# ...
|
|
</Location>
|
|
</highlight>
|
|
|
|
<note><title>When to use <directive
|
|
type="section">Location</directive></title>
|
|
|
|
<p>Use <directive type="section">Location</directive> to apply
|
|
directives to content that lives outside the filesystem. For
|
|
content that lives in the filesystem, use <directive
|
|
type="section" module="core">Directory</directive> and <directive
|
|
type="section" module="core">Files</directive>. An exception is
|
|
<code><Location "/"></code>, which is an easy way to
|
|
apply a configuration to the entire server.</p>
|
|
</note>
|
|
|
|
<p>For all origin (non-proxy) requests, the URL to be matched is a
|
|
URL-path of the form <code>/path/</code>. <em>No scheme, hostname,
|
|
port, or query string may be included.</em> For proxy requests, the
|
|
URL to be matched is of the form
|
|
<code>scheme://servername/path</code>, and you must include the
|
|
prefix.</p>
|
|
|
|
<p>The URL may use wildcards. In a wild-card string, <code>?</code> matches
|
|
any single character, and <code>*</code> matches any sequences of
|
|
characters. Neither wildcard character matches a / in the URL-path.</p>
|
|
|
|
<p><glossary ref="regex">Regular expressions</glossary>
|
|
can also be used, with the addition of the <code>~</code>
|
|
character. For example:</p>
|
|
|
|
<highlight language="config">
|
|
<Location ~ "/(extra|special)/data">
|
|
#...
|
|
</Location>
|
|
</highlight>
|
|
|
|
<p>would match URLs that contained the substring <code>/extra/data</code>
|
|
or <code>/special/data</code>. The directive <directive
|
|
type="section" module="core">LocationMatch</directive> behaves
|
|
identical to the regex version of <directive
|
|
type="section">Location</directive>, and is preferred, for the
|
|
simple reason that <code>~</code> is hard to distinguish from
|
|
<code>-</code> in many fonts.</p>
|
|
|
|
<p>The <directive type="section">Location</directive>
|
|
functionality is especially useful when combined with the
|
|
<directive module="core">SetHandler</directive>
|
|
directive. For example, to enable status requests but allow them
|
|
only from browsers at <code>example.com</code>, you might use:</p>
|
|
|
|
<highlight language="config">
|
|
<Location "/status">
|
|
SetHandler server-status
|
|
Require host example.com
|
|
</Location>
|
|
</highlight>
|
|
|
|
<note><title>Note about / (slash)</title>
|
|
<p>The slash character has special meaning depending on where in a
|
|
URL it appears. People may be used to its behavior in the filesystem
|
|
where multiple adjacent slashes are frequently collapsed to a single
|
|
slash (<em>i.e.</em>, <code>/home///foo</code> is the same as
|
|
<code>/home/foo</code>). In URL-space this is not necessarily true.
|
|
The <directive type="section" module="core">LocationMatch</directive>
|
|
directive and the regex version of <directive type="section"
|
|
>Location</directive> require you to explicitly specify multiple
|
|
slashes if that is your intention.</p>
|
|
|
|
<p>For example, <code><LocationMatch "^/abc"></code> would match
|
|
the request URL <code>/abc</code> but not the request URL <code>
|
|
//abc</code>. The (non-regex) <directive type="section"
|
|
>Location</directive> directive behaves similarly when used for
|
|
proxy requests. But when (non-regex) <directive type="section"
|
|
>Location</directive> is used for non-proxy requests it will
|
|
implicitly match multiple slashes with a single slash. For example,
|
|
if you specify <code><Location "/abc/def"></code> and the
|
|
request is to <code>/abc//def</code> then it will match.</p>
|
|
</note>
|
|
</usage>

<directivesynopsis>
|
|
<name>Mutex</name>
|
|
<description>Configures mutex mechanism and lock file directory for all
|
|
or specified mutexes</description>
|
|
<syntax>Mutex <var>mechanism</var> [default|<var>mutex-name</var>] ... [OmitPID]</syntax>
|
|
<default>Mutex default</default>
|
|
<contextlist><context>server config</context></contextlist>
|
|
<compatibility>Available in Apache HTTP Server 2.3.4 and later</compatibility>
|
|
|
|
<usage>
|
|
<p>The <directive>Mutex</directive> directive sets the mechanism,
|
|
and optionally the lock file location, that httpd and modules use
|
|
to serialize access to resources. Specify <code>default</code> as
|
|
the second argument to change the settings for all mutexes; specify
|
|
a mutex name (see table below) as the second argument to override
|
|
defaults only for that mutex.</p>
|
|
|
|
<p>The <directive>Mutex</directive> directive is typically used in
|
|
the following exceptional situations:</p>
|
|
|
|
<ul>
|
|
<li>change the mutex mechanism when the default mechanism selected
|
|
by <glossary>APR</glossary> has a functional or performance
|
|
problem</li>
|
|
|
|
<li>change the directory used by file-based mutexes when the
|
|
default directory does not support locking</li>
|
|
</ul>
|
|
|
|
<note><title>Supported modules</title>
|
|
<p>This directive only configures mutexes which have been registered
|
|
with the core server using the <code>ap_mutex_register()</code> API.
|
|
All modules bundled with httpd support the <directive>Mutex</directive>
|
|
directive, but third-party modules may not. Consult the documentation
|
|
of the third-party module, which must indicate the mutex name(s) which
|
|
can be configured if this directive is supported.</p>
|
|
</note>
|
|
|
|
<p>The following mutex <em>mechanisms</em> are available:</p>
|
|
<ul>
|
|
<li><code>default | yes</code>
|
|
<p>This selects the default locking implementation, as determined by
|
|
<glossary>APR</glossary>. The default locking implementation can
|
|
be displayed by running <program>httpd</program> with the
|
|
<code>-V</code> option.</p></li>
|
|
|
|
<li><code>none | no</code>
|
|
<p>This effectively disables the mutex, and is only allowed for a
|
|
mutex if the module indicates that it is a valid choice. Consult the
|
|
module documentation for more information.</p></li>
|
|
|
|
<li><code>posixsem</code>
|
|
<p>This is a mutex variant based on a Posix semaphore.</p>
|
|
|
|
<note type="warning"><title>Warning</title>
|
|
<p>The semaphore ownership is not recovered if a thread in the process
|
|
holding the mutex segfaults, resulting in a hang of the web server.</p>
|
|
</note>
|
|
</li>
|
|
|
|
<li><code>sysvsem</code>
|
|
<p>This is a mutex variant based on a SystemV IPC semaphore.</p>
|
|
|
|
<note type="warning"><title>Warning</title>
|
|
<p>It is possible to "leak" SysV semaphores if processes crash
|
|
before the semaphore is removed.</p>
|
|
</note>
|
|
|
|
<note type="warning"><title>Security</title>
|
|
<p>The semaphore API allows for a denial of service attack by any
|
|
CGIs running under the same uid as the webserver (<em>i.e.</em>,
|
|
all CGIs, unless you use something like <program>suexec</program>
|
|
or <code>cgiwrapper</code>).</p>
|
|
</note>
|
|
</li>
|
|
|
|
<li><code>sem</code>
|
|
<p>This selects the "best" available semaphore implementation, choosing
|
|
between Posix and SystemV IPC semaphores, in that order.</p></li>
|
|
|
|
<li><code>pthread</code>
|
|
<p>This is a mutex variant based on cross-process Posix thread
|
|
mutexes.</p>
|
|
|
|
<note type="warning"><title>Warning</title>
|
|
<p>On most systems, if a child process terminates abnormally while
|
|
holding a mutex that uses this implementation, the server will deadlock
|
|
and stop responding to requests. When this occurs, the server will
|
|
require a manual restart to recover.</p>
|
|
<p>Solaris and Linux are notable exceptions as they provide a mechanism which
|
|
usually allows the mutex to be recovered after a child process
|
|
terminates abnormally while holding a mutex.</p>
|
|
<p>If your system is POSIX compliant or if it implements the
|
|
<code>pthread_mutexattr_setrobust_np()</code> function, you may be able
|
|
to use the <code>pthread</code> option safely.</p>
|
|
</note>
|
|
</li>
|
|
|
|
<li><code>fcntl:/path/to/mutex</code>
|
|
<p>This is a mutex variant where a physical (lock-)file and the
|
|
<code>fcntl()</code> function are used as the mutex.</p>
|
|
|
|
<note type="warning"><title>Warning</title>
|
|
<p>When multiple mutexes based on this mechanism are used within
|
|
multi-threaded, multi-process environments, deadlock errors (EDEADLK)
|
|
can be reported for valid mutex operations if <code>fcntl()</code>
|
|
is not thread-aware, such as on Solaris.</p>
|
|
</note>
|
|
</li>
|
|
|
|
<li><code>flock:/path/to/mutex</code>
|
|
<p>This is similar to the <code>fcntl:/path/to/mutex</code> method
|
|
with the exception that the <code>flock()</code> function is used to
|
|
provide file locking.</p></li>
|
|
|
|
<li><code>file:/path/to/mutex</code>
|
|
<p>This selects the "best" available file locking implementation,
|
|
choosing between <code>fcntl</code> and <code>flock</code>, in that
|
|
order.</p></li>
|
|
</ul>
|
|
|
|
<p>Most mechanisms are only available on selected platforms, where the
|
|
underlying platform and <glossary>APR</glossary> support it. Mechanisms
|
|
which aren't available on all platforms are <em>posixsem</em>,
|
|
<em>sysvsem</em>, <em>sem</em>, <em>pthread</em>, <em>fcntl</em>,
|
|
<em>flock</em>, and <em>file</em>.</p>
|
|
|
|
<p>With the file-based mechanisms <em>fcntl</em> and <em>flock</em>,
|
|
the path, if provided, is a directory where the lock file will be created.
|
|
The default directory is httpd's run-time file directory,
|
|
<directive module="core">DefaultRuntimeDir</directive>. If a relative
|
|
path is provided, it is relative to
|
|
<directive module="core">DefaultRuntimeDir</directive>. Always use a local
|
|
disk filesystem for <code>/path/to/mutex</code> and never a directory residing
|
|
on a NFS- or AFS-filesystem. The basename of the file will be the mutex
|
|
type, an optional instance string provided by the module, and unless the
|
|
<code>OmitPID</code> keyword is specified, the process id of the httpd
|
|
parent process will be appended to make the file name unique, avoiding
|
|
conflicts when multiple httpd instances share a lock file directory. For
|
|
example, if the mutex name is <code>mpm-accept</code> and the lock file
|
|
directory is <code>/var/httpd/locks</code>, the lock file name for the
|
|
httpd instance with parent process id 12345 would be
|
|
<code>/var/httpd/locks/mpm-accept.12345</code>.</p>
|
|
|
|
<note type="warning"><title>Security</title>
|
|
<p>It is best to <em>avoid</em> putting mutex files in a world-writable
|
|
directory such as <code>/var/tmp</code> because someone could create
|
|
a denial of service attack and prevent the server from starting by
|
|
creating a lockfile with the same name as the one the server will try
|
|
to create.</p>
|
|
</note>
|
|
|
|
<p>The following table documents the names of mutexes used by httpd
|
|
and bundled modules.</p>
|
|
|
|
<table border="1" style="zebra">
|
|
<tr>
|
|
<th>Mutex name</th>
|
|
<th>Module(s)</th>
|
|
<th>Protected resource</th>
|
|
</tr>
|
|
<tr>
|
|
<td><code>mpm-accept</code></td>
|
|
<td><module>prefork</module> and <module>worker</module> MPMs</td>
|
|
<td>incoming connections, to avoid the thundering herd problem;
|
|
for more information, refer to the
|
|
<a href="../misc/perf-tuning.html">performance tuning</a>
|
|
documentation</td>
|
|
</tr>
|
|
<tr>
|
|
<td><code>authdigest-client</code></td>
|
|
<td><module>mod_auth_digest</module></td>
|
|
<td>client list in shared memory</td>
|
|
</tr>
|
|
<tr>
|
|
<td><code>authdigest-opaque</code></td>
|
|
<td><module>mod_auth_digest</module></td>
|
|
<td>counter in shared memory</td>
|
|
</tr>
|
|
<tr>
|
|
<td><code>ldap-cache</code></td>
|
|
<td><module>mod_ldap</module></td>
|
|
<td>LDAP result cache</td>
|
|
</tr>
|
|
<tr>
|
|
<td><code>rewrite-map</code></td>
|
|
<td><module>mod_rewrite</module></td>
|
|
<td>communication with external mapping programs, to avoid
|
|
intermixed I/O from multiple requests</td>
|
|
</tr>
|
|
<tr>
|
|
<td><code>ssl-cache</code></td>
|
|
<td><module>mod_ssl</module></td>
|
|
<td>SSL session cache</td>
|
|
</tr>
|
|
<tr>
|
|
<td><code>ssl-stapling</code></td>
|
|
<td><module>mod_ssl</module></td>
|
|
<td>OCSP stapling response cache</td>
|
|
</tr>
|
|
<tr>
|
|
<td><code>watchdog-callback</code></td>
|
|
<td><module>mod_watchdog</module></td>
|
|
<td>callback function of a particular client module</td>
|
|
</tr>
|
|
</table>
|
|
|
|
<p>The <code>OmitPID</code> keyword suppresses the addition of the httpd
|
|
parent process id from the lock file name.</p>
|
|
|
|
<p>In the following example, the mutex mechanism for the MPM accept
|
|
mutex will be changed from the compiled-in default to <code>fcntl</code>,
|
|
with the associated lock file created in directory
|
|
<code>/var/httpd/locks</code>. The mutex mechanism for all other mutexes
|
|
will be changed from the compiled-in default to <code>sysvsem</code>.</p>
|
|
|
|
<highlight language="config">
|
|
Mutex sysvsem default
|
|
Mutex fcntl:/var/httpd/locks mpm-accept
|
|
</highlight>
|
|
</usage>

<directivesynopsis>
|
|
<name>Options</name>
|
|
<description>Configures what features are available in a particular
|
|
directory</description>
|
|
<syntax>Options
|
|
[+|-]<var>option</var> [[+|-]<var>option</var>] ...</syntax>
|
|
<default>Options FollowSymlinks</default>
|
|
<contextlist><context>server config</context><context>virtual host</context>
|
|
<context>directory</context><context>.htaccess</context>
|
|
</contextlist>
|
|
<override>Options</override>
|
|
<compatibility>The default was changed from All to FollowSymlinks in 2.3.11</compatibility>
|
|
|
|
<usage>
|
|
<p>The <directive>Options</directive> directive controls which
|
|
server features are available in a particular directory.</p>
|
|
|
|
<p><var>option</var> can be set to <code>None</code>, in which
|
|
case none of the extra features are enabled, or one or more of
|
|
the following:</p>
|
|
|
|
<dl>
|
|
<dt><code>All</code></dt>
|
|
|
|
<dd>All options except for <code>MultiViews</code>.</dd>
|
|
|
|
<dt><code>ExecCGI</code></dt>
|
|
|
|
<dd>
|
|
Execution of CGI scripts using <module>mod_cgi</module>
|
|
is permitted.</dd>
|
|
|
|
<dt><code>FollowSymLinks</code></dt>
|
|
|
|
<dd>
|
|
The server will follow symbolic links in this directory. This is
|
|
the default setting.
|
|
<note>
|
|
<p>Even though the server follows the symlink it does <em>not</em>
|
|
change the pathname used to match against <directive type="section"
|
|
module="core">Directory</directive> sections.</p>
|
|
|
|
<p>The <code>FollowSymLinks</code> and
|
|
<code>SymLinksIfOwnerMatch</code> <directive
|
|
module="core">Options</directive> work only in <directive
|
|
type="section" module="core">Directory</directive> sections or
|
|
<code>.htaccess</code> files.</p>
|
|
|
|
<p>Omitting this option should not be considered a security restriction,
|
|
since symlink testing is subject to race conditions that make it
|
|
circumventable.</p>
|
|
</note></dd>
|
|
|
|
<dt><code>Includes</code></dt>
|
|
|
|
<dd>
|
|
Server-side includes provided by <module>mod_include</module>
|
|
are permitted.</dd>
|
|
|
|
<dt><code>IncludesNOEXEC</code></dt>
|
|
|
|
<dd>
|
|
|
|
Server-side includes are permitted, but the <code>#exec
|
|
cmd</code> and <code>#exec cgi</code> are disabled. It is still
|
|
possible to <code>#include virtual</code> CGI scripts from
|
|
<directive module="mod_alias">ScriptAlias</directive>ed
|
|
directories.</dd>
|
|
|
|
<dt><code>Indexes</code></dt>
|
|
|
|
<dd>
|
|
If a URL which maps to a directory is requested and there
|
|
is no <directive module="mod_dir">DirectoryIndex</directive>
|
|
(<em>e.g.</em>, <code>index.html</code>) in that directory, then
|
|
<module>mod_autoindex</module> will return a formatted listing
|
|
of the directory.</dd>
|
|
|
|
<dt><code>MultiViews</code></dt>
|
|
|
|
<dd>
|
|
<a href="../content-negotiation.html">Content negotiated</a>
|
|
"MultiViews" are allowed using
|
|
<module>mod_negotiation</module>.
|
|
<note><title>Note</title> <p>This option gets ignored if set
|
|
anywhere other than <directive module="core" type="section"
|
|
>Directory</directive>, as <module>mod_negotiation</module>
|
|
needs real resources to compare against and evaluate from.</p></note>
|
|
</dd>
|
|
|
|
<dt><code>SymLinksIfOwnerMatch</code></dt>
|
|
|
|
<dd>The server will only follow symbolic links for which the
|
|
target file or directory is owned by the same user id as the
|
|
link.
|
|
|
|
<note><title>Note</title>
|
|
<p>The <code>FollowSymLinks</code> and
|
|
<code>SymLinksIfOwnerMatch</code> <directive
|
|
module="core">Options</directive> work only in <directive
|
|
type="section" module="core">Directory</directive> sections or
|
|
<code>.htaccess</code> files.</p>
|
|
|
|
<p>This option should not be considered a security restriction,
|
|
since symlink testing is subject to race conditions that make it
|
|
circumventable.</p>
|
|
</note> </dd>
|
|
</dl>
|
|
|
|
<p>Normally, if multiple <directive>Options</directive> could
|
|
apply to a directory, then the most specific one is used and
|
|
others are ignored; the options are not merged. (See <a
|
|
href="../sections.html#merging">how sections are merged</a>.)
|
|
However if <em>all</em> the options on the
|
|
<directive>Options</directive> directive are preceded by a
|
|
<code>+</code> or <code>-</code> symbol, the options are
|
|
merged. Any options preceded by a <code>+</code> are added to the
|
|
options currently in force, and any options preceded by a
|
|
<code>-</code> are removed from the options currently in
|
|
force. </p>
|
|
|
|
<note><title>Note</title>
|
|
<p>Mixing <directive>Options</directive> with a <code>+</code> or
|
|
<code>-</code> with those without is not valid syntax and will be
|
|
rejected during server startup by the syntax check with an abort.</p>
|
|
</note>
|
|
|
|
<p>For example, without any <code>+</code> and <code>-</code> symbols:</p>
|
|
|
|
<highlight language="config">
|
|
<Directory "/web/docs">
|
|
Options Indexes FollowSymLinks
|
|
</Directory>
|
|
|
|
<Directory "/web/docs/spec">
|
|
Options Includes
|
|
</Directory>
|
|
</highlight>
|
|
|
|
<p>then only <code>Includes</code> will be set for the
|
|
<code>/web/docs/spec</code> directory. However if the second
|
|
<directive>Options</directive> directive uses the <code>+</code> and
|
|
<code>-</code> symbols:</p>
|
|
|
|
<highlight language="config">
|
|
<Directory "/web/docs">
|
|
Options Indexes FollowSymLinks
|
|
</Directory>
|
|
|
|
<Directory "/web/docs/spec">
|
|
Options +Includes -Indexes
|
|
</Directory>
|
|
</highlight>
|
|
|
|
<p>then the options <code>FollowSymLinks</code> and
|
|
<code>Includes</code> are set for the <code>/web/docs/spec</code>
|
|
directory.</p>
|
|
|
|
<note><title>Note</title>
|
|
<p>Using <code>-IncludesNOEXEC</code> or
|
|
<code>-Includes</code> disables server-side includes completely
|
|
regardless of the previous setting.</p>
|
|
</note>
|
|
|
|
<p>The default in the absence of any other settings is
|
|
<code>FollowSymlinks</code>.</p>
|
|
</usage>

<directivesynopsis type="section">
|
|
<name>VirtualHost</name>
|
|
<description>Contains directives that apply only to a specific
|
|
hostname or IP address</description>
|
|
<syntax><VirtualHost
|
|
<var>addr</var>[:<var>port</var>] [<var>addr</var>[:<var>port</var>]]
|
|
...> ... </VirtualHost></syntax>
|
|
<contextlist><context>server config</context></contextlist>
|
|
|
|
<usage>
|
|
<p><directive type="section">VirtualHost</directive> and
|
|
<code></VirtualHost></code> are used to enclose a group of
|
|
directives that will apply only to a particular virtual host. Any
|
|
directive that is allowed in a virtual host context may be
|
|
used. When the server receives a request for a document on a
|
|
particular virtual host, it uses the configuration directives
|
|
enclosed in the <directive type="section">VirtualHost</directive>
|
|
section. <var>Addr</var> can be any of the following, optionally followed by
|
|
a colon and a port number (or *):</p>
|
|
|
|
<ul>
|
|
<li>The IP address of the virtual host;</li>
|
|
|
|
<li>A fully qualified domain name for the IP address of the
|
|
virtual host (not recommended);</li>
|
|
|
|
<li>The character <code>*</code>, which acts as a wildcard and matches
|
|
any IP address.</li>
|
|
|
|
<li>The string <code>_default_</code>, which is an alias for <code>*</code></li>
|
|
|
|
</ul>
|
|
|
|
<highlight language="config">
|
|
<VirtualHost 10.1.2.3:80>
|
|
ServerAdmin webmaster@host.example.com
|
|
DocumentRoot "/www/docs/host.example.com"
|
|
ServerName host.example.com
|
|
ErrorLog "logs/host.example.com-error_log"
|
|
TransferLog "logs/host.example.com-access_log"
|
|
</VirtualHost>
|
|
</highlight>
|
|
|
|
|
|
<p>IPv6 addresses must be specified in square brackets because
|
|
the optional port number could not be determined otherwise. An
|
|
IPv6 example is shown below:</p>
|
|
|
|
<highlight language="config">
|
|
<VirtualHost [2001:db8::a00:20ff:fea7:ccea]:80>
|
|
ServerAdmin webmaster@host.example.com
|
|
DocumentRoot "/www/docs/host.example.com"
|
|
ServerName host.example.com
|
|
ErrorLog "logs/host.example.com-error_log"
|
|
TransferLog "logs/host.example.com-access_log"
|
|
</VirtualHost>
|
|
</highlight>
|
|
|
|
<p>Each Virtual Host must correspond to a different IP address,
|
|
different port number, or a different host name for the server,
|
|
in the former case the server machine must be configured to
|
|
accept IP packets for multiple addresses. (If the machine does
|
|
not have multiple network interfaces, then this can be
|
|
accomplished with the <code>ifconfig alias</code> command -- if
|
|
your OS supports it).</p>
|
|
|
|
<note><title>Note</title>
|
|
<p>The use of <directive type="section">VirtualHost</directive> does
|
|
<strong>not</strong> affect what addresses Apache httpd listens on. You
|
|
may need to ensure that Apache httpd is listening on the correct addresses
|
|
using <directive module="mpm_common">Listen</directive>.</p>
|
|
</note>
|
|
|
|
<p>A <directive module="core">ServerName</directive> should be
|
|
specified inside each <directive
|
|
type="section">VirtualHost</directive> block. If it is absent, the
|
|
<directive module="core">ServerName</directive> from the "main"
|
|
server configuration will be inherited.</p>
|
|
|
|
<p>When a request is received, the server first maps it to the best matching
|
|
<directive type="section">VirtualHost</directive> based on the local
|
|
IP address and port combination only. Non-wildcards have a higher
|
|
precedence. If no match based on IP and port occurs at all, the
|
|
"main" server configuration is used.</p>
|
|
|
|
<p>If multiple virtual hosts contain the best matching IP address and port,
|
|
the server selects from these virtual hosts the best match based on the
|
|
requested hostname. If no matching name-based virtual host is found,
|
|
then the first listed virtual host that matched the IP address will be
|
|
used. As a consequence, the first listed virtual host for a given IP address
|
|
and port combination is the default virtual host for that IP and port
|
|
combination.</p>
|
|
|
|
<note type="warning"><title>Security</title>
|
|
<p>See the <a href="../misc/security_tips.html">security tips</a>
|
|
document for details on why your security could be compromised if the
|
|
directory where log files are stored is writable by anyone other
|
|
than the user that starts the server.</p>
|
|
</note>
|
|
</usage>
